During their studies, students
acquire both theoretical and practical knowledge. Theoretical
subjects include basic engineering disciplines such as engineering
graphics, materials science, technical mechanics, hydraulics, and
electrical engineering. These disciplines develop students'
technical thinking skills and teach them to solve complex problems.
In addition, special subjects include the construction of
technological machines, their principles of operation, and methods
of their design and use.

Another feature of the
specialty "Technological machines and equipment" is its
versatility. Graduates of this direction are engaged in
various
can work in the industry. For
example, they can work as engineers, technologists, mechanics, or
equipment repair and maintenance specialists in manufacturing
enterprises. There is also the opportunity to work in design
bureaus, research centers, or service
companies.
Nowadays, automation and
digitalization processes are rapidly developing in the industrial
sector. In this regard, graduates of these specialties should not
be limited to mechanical knowledge alone, but also master modern
software systems. For example, such areas as computer-aided design
(CAD), production management systems, and automated network
management also play an important role. This increases the
competitiveness of students.
